Tomas Garcia
Tomas Garcia is VP of Technology and Digital Media at the LACMA, guiding the digital vision of one of the nation’s pioneering arts institutions. In this capacity he leads the digital operations of a multi-generational and diverse workforce while materializing the groundwork for the future of technology in museums. He also oversees LACMA’s renowned Art + Technology Program, embedding him in the tenuous crossroads of artists working with technology corporations. He finds ongoing inspiration in the ability of artists to disintegrate presented intentions behind technology and innovation for reinterpretation as tools for expression of unique human perspectives.
